Microchip Technology 32-bit MCU families

03 March, 2010 | Microchip Technology Australia

Microchip Technology has released three new families of microcontrollers that provide up to 128 KB of RAM and various connectivity options, including 10/100 Mbps ethernet, two CAN2.0b controllers, USB host, device and OTG, and six UART, five I2C and four SPI ports.

TE board-to-board screw-down jumper assembly

03 March, 2010 | Avnet Electronics Marketing

A TE screw-down jumper assembly provides the electrical connection between adjacent printed circuit boards arranged in a string of LED PCBs. The screw fastens to threaded holes in an aluminium-clad PCB base or into a separate aluminium heat sink used with FR4 boards.

Mean Well WDR-120 slim DIN rail power supply series

03 March, 2010 | Soanar Limited

Mean Well has released the WDR-120 slim DIN rail power supply series. It joins the 240 and 480 W version of the same series and features a wide input range of 180~550 VAC which can be used in general power systems with single-phase 240 VAC input or can capture one phase from the 415 VAC three-phase system.

Powerbox PB315 high-efficiency converter

03 March, 2010 | Powerbox Australia Pty Ltd

Powerbox has designed a high-efficiency converter to supply locomotive headlights. The dual output PB315 replaces dropping resistors currently used to dim incandescent headlights on locomotives.
